Parameters is a quarterly academic journal published by the United States Army War College (USAWC) Press.[1]
Background
Since 1971, it has published publications based on academic work on strategy, Landpower, national security and focuses on geostrategic issues.[2] It is also known as the US Army War College quarterly parameters[3] & U.S. Army's senior professional journal. Since its creation, it has 1049 publications.[4] Parameters is available online through its home page and though ProQuest and UMI.[5]
Editor in chef is Antulio J. Echevarria II.[3]
